Ninche Alston is a scholar working on Oncology, Pharmacology and Surgery. According to data from OpenAlex, Ninche Alston has authored 13 papers receiving a total of 352 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Oncology, 4 papers in Pharmacology and 3 papers in Surgery. Recurrent topics in Ninche Alston's work include Inflammatory mediators and NSAID effects (4 papers), Drug Transport and Resistance Mechanisms (3 papers) and Cancer, Stress, Anesthesia, and Immune Response (2 papers). Ninche Alston is often cited by papers focused on Inflammatory mediators and NSAID effects (4 papers), Drug Transport and Resistance Mechanisms (3 papers) and Cancer, Stress, Anesthesia, and Immune Response (2 papers). Ninche Alston collaborates with scholars based in United States, Russia and Australia. Ninche Alston's co-authors include Soosan Ghazizadeh, Basil Rigas, Nengtai Ouyang, Liqun Huang, Gerardo G. Mackenzie, George Mattheolabakis, Yoshio Fujitani, Jay D. Kormish, Maureen Gannon and Christopher V.E. Wright and has published in prestigious journals such as Gastroenterology, PLoS ONE and Molecular and Cellular Biology.
